Tips to play Dokkaebi soloQ for newbie? by HauntedGoalkeeper in SiegeAcademy

[–]Rhabcp 0 points1 point  (0 children)

Always follow someone. They'll cover you since you'll probably forget to switch weapons for long/short range fights.

Use your first call to reveal roamers right away, but keep next ones for when whole team is close to site.

I don't use her that much but boy is she fun to use in Basement Bank:

  • keep the drone in garage safe and lay down at garage entry to snipe those hiding under ambulance. Then push to watch the double door. Generally your mates will attack server room so you might push site in the end.

How to get better weapon control by Delicious_Present_52 in SiegeAcademy

[–]Rhabcp 0 points1 point  (0 children)

Obvious answer: put on a podcast, go to shooting range and simply train to keep shooting in a specific zone, maybe tweak by one or two degrees sensitivity.

Other answer: honestly R6 is not really a game where mastering a full clip unloading is necessary. It's not Apex.

Maybe doing a mental shift that it's okay to not be able to perfectly handle it will make you work more on placing your sight better to avoid long unloading in the first place
